1. Your Sheets Feel Rough or Stiff
If your sheets feel like sandpaper instead of soft cotton, they’ve likely worn out. Bedding should feel smooth and cozy when you get into bed—not irritating.
Good bedding gets softer with every wash, especially when made from 100% cotton. It’s breathable, gentle on the skin, and helps create a more restful sleep experience for both of you.
2. You Wake Up Sweaty or Uncomfortable
If you're waking up hot, kicking off blankets, or flipping your pillow to the cool side, your bedding might be trapping heat.

3. Your Bedding Looks Faded or Worn
When your sheets start to lose color, feel thin, or show fraying edges, it’s time to replace them. Bedding should last up to 30 washes while holding its shape and feel.

Questions You May Ask
1. Why am I waking up sweaty at night?
Your bedding could be trapping heat. Look for breathable fabrics like cotton that help regulate your body temperature while you sleep.
2. Can new bedding really improve my sleep quality?
Absolutely. Comfortable, clean, and breathable bedding supports deeper sleep and helps you wake up feeling more refreshed.
3. How many washes should good bedding last?
Quality bedding should hold up well for up to 30 washes, maintaining its softness, shape, and color when cared for properly.
4. Do couples need different bedding preferences?
It’s common for couples to sleep at different temperatures. Choosing breathable and temperature-regulating sheets can help both partners stay comfortable.
5. Is cotton bedding better than microfiber?
Cotton is natural, breathable, and softens with every wash, while microfiber is synthetic and may trap more heat. Cotton is usually preferred for long-term comfort.
